What this episode covers
The Unruly Duo creep into the basement to shed light on the murky world where monsters lurk. Does anything we don’t understand or want to face get dumped into the monster bin? Creepy crawlies, voracious reptiles, and pod people get all the attention, but what about the monsters living among us? As the world lurches off its axis, the human mind digs deep into the basement of fear. With a nod to the classic film scaries of the '30s and '40s (Bela Lugosi anyone?), John and Lynn take a tour of the layered lairs of monsters. Lock your doors…
